当前位置:首页 > 学习方法 > 正文内容

捕鱼游戏源码,全新捕鱼游戏源码揭秘

wzgly2个月前 (06-22)学习方法1
捕鱼游戏源码是一套完整的游戏开发资源,包括游戏设计、图形界面、逻辑算法等,旨在帮助开发者快速构建自己的捕鱼游戏,该源码可能包含丰富的鱼类资源、用户界面元素和游戏规则,支持多种平台和设备,适合有经验的程序员或游戏开发团队进行二次开发和商业化。

用户提问:我最近想开发一个捕鱼游戏,想了解一下捕鱼游戏源码的相关信息,能给我推荐一些吗?

解答:当然可以,捕鱼游戏源码是游戏开发中非常重要的一部分,它决定了游戏的运行逻辑、界面设计和用户体验,下面我会从几个来详细解答你的问题。

一:捕鱼游戏源码的类型

  1. 原生开发源码:这类源码是基于原生语言(如C++、Java)开发的,性能优越,但开发难度较大。
  2. Unity3D源码:Unity3D是一款流行的游戏开发引擎,其捕鱼游戏源码可以快速实现3D效果,适合追求视觉效果的游戏。
  3. Cocos2d-x源码:Cocos2d-x是一款开源的游戏开发框架,捕鱼游戏源码易于上手,适合初学者。
  4. HTML5源码:HTML5源码适合开发网页版捕鱼游戏,跨平台性强,但性能相对较弱。
  5. 微信小程序源码:微信小程序源码适合开发微信平台上的捕鱼游戏,用户群体广泛,但功能受限。

二:捕鱼游戏源码的购买渠道

  1. 官方网站:许多游戏开发公司会在官方网站上出售自己的捕鱼游戏源码。
  2. 第三方平台:如淘宝、京东等电商平台上有许多游戏源码出售,但需谨慎选择,避免购买到盗版或质量差的源码。
  3. 开源社区:GitHub、码云等开源社区上有许多免费的游戏源码,但可能需要自行修改和优化。
  4. 个人开发者:一些个人开发者也会出售自己的捕鱼游戏源码,价格相对较低,但需注意版权问题。
  5. 游戏开发论坛:在游戏开发论坛上,可以找到一些免费或低价的捕鱼游戏源码。

三:捕鱼游戏源码的购买注意事项

  1. 功能完整性:确保源码包含游戏的所有功能,如捕鱼、升级、道具等。
  2. 技术支持:购买源码时,了解是否有技术支持,以便在开发过程中遇到问题能够及时解决。
  3. 兼容性:确保源码能够在不同平台和设备上正常运行。
  4. 版权问题:避免购买盗版或侵权源码,以免产生法律风险。
  5. 更新频率:了解源码的更新频率,确保游戏能够及时修复漏洞和添加新功能。

四:捕鱼游戏源码的开发流程

  1. 需求分析:明确游戏的目标用户、功能和风格。
  2. 设计界面:根据需求设计游戏的界面和用户交互。
  3. 编写代码:使用选择的开发工具和语言编写游戏代码。
  4. 测试与调试:对游戏进行测试,修复bug,确保游戏稳定运行。
  5. 优化性能:对游戏进行性能优化,提高运行速度和流畅度。
  6. 发布上线:将游戏发布到目标平台,供用户下载和体验。

五:捕鱼游戏源码的开发技巧

  1. 模块化设计:将游戏功能划分为独立的模块,便于开发和维护。
  2. 使用面向对象编程:提高代码的可读性和可复用性。
  3. 优化资源加载:合理管理游戏资源,减少加载时间。
  4. 使用性能优化工具:如Profiler等工具,分析游戏性能,找出瓶颈进行优化。
  5. 学习相关技术:了解游戏开发相关的技术,如图形学、音效处理等,提高自己的技术水平。

通过以上解答,相信你已经对捕鱼游戏源码有了更深入的了解,在开发过程中,根据自身需求选择合适的源码,注意购买渠道和注意事项,相信你一定能够开发出一款优秀的捕鱼游戏。

捕鱼游戏源码

其他相关扩展阅读资料参考文献:

捕鱼游戏源码的核心技术架构

  1. 游戏引擎选择
    捕鱼游戏源码开发通常基于Unity或Unreal引擎,其中Unity因跨平台兼容性强、开发周期短,成为主流选择,开发者需优先评估引擎的物理模拟能力、图形渲染效率及社区支持程度,确保项目可扩展性。

  2. 物理引擎与碰撞检测
    游戏中的鱼群运动轨迹、子弹与目标的碰撞逻辑依赖物理引擎(如Box2D)。碰撞检测算法的精度直接影响玩家体验,需通过优化计算频率和碰撞体划分,避免卡顿或误判。

  3. 图形渲染技术
    高质量的视觉效果是捕鱼游戏吸引用户的关键。粒子特效用于模拟水花与爆炸,而3D建模与光影渲染则增强场景沉浸感,开发者需平衡性能消耗与画面表现,避免设备兼容性问题。

    捕鱼游戏源码

捕鱼游戏源码的开发流程

  1. 需求分析与原型设计
    开发前需明确游戏类型(如休闲、竞技)及核心玩法。基础功能包括鱼群生成、得分系统和关卡设计,需通过原型验证可行性,减少后期返工成本。

  2. 前端与后端开发分工
    前端负责游戏界面交互与动画效果,后端需处理玩家数据存储、实时匹配及服务器逻辑。数据库设计需支持高并发访问,建议采用MySQL或MongoDB,确保数据安全与快速响应。

  3. 测试与优化阶段
    开发完成后需进行多设备兼容性测试,修复卡顿、闪退等BUG。性能优化重点在于降低内存占用和提升帧率,可通过代码压缩、资源管理及算法优化实现。

捕鱼游戏源码的盈利模式设计

捕鱼游戏源码
  1. 虚拟道具与付费系统
    引入金币、渔网、加速道具等虚拟物品,付费转化率与道具稀缺性密切相关,需设计合理的获取途径,如通过任务解锁或充值购买,避免玩家反感。

  2. 会员系统与等级特权
    通过VIP等级划分,提供专属福利(如每日双倍奖励、专属渔场)。会员体系需与社交功能结合,鼓励玩家邀请好友提升活跃度。

  3. 赛事活动与奖励机制
    定期举办捕鱼比赛、排行榜挑战等活动,奖励发放需及时且具有吸引力,如实物奖励或游戏内特权,以刺激用户参与。

捕鱼游戏源码的安全防护措施

  1. 数据加密与防篡改
    玩家数据(如积分、道具)需通过AES加密存储,防止数据被恶意修改或泄露,建议采用后端校验机制,确保数据真实性。

  2. 反作弊系统部署
    针对外挂、刷鱼等行为,需集成实时监控模块。关键点在于检测异常操作模式,如通过服务器端验证玩家行为,而非依赖客户端逻辑。

  3. 服务器稳定性保障
    采用分布式服务器架构,负载均衡技术可应对高并发流量,需定期进行压力测试,确保游戏在节假日或活动期间不崩溃。

捕鱼游戏源码的未来发展趋势

  1. AI技术提升游戏智能
    引入AI算法优化鱼群行为路径,动态调整难度与玩家匹配,增强游戏可玩性,通过机器学习分析玩家操作习惯,生成更真实的鱼群反应。

  2. 区块链技术应用
    部分项目尝试将区块链用于虚拟资产交易,确保道具所有权透明化,但需注意技术门槛与用户接受度,避免过度复杂化。

  3. 跨平台开发与云游戏支持
    通过Unity的跨平台特性,实现PC、移动端及主机端同步上线,云游戏技术可降低设备性能要求,但需解决延迟与网络稳定性问题。


捕鱼游戏源码开发涉及技术、商业与安全多维度挑战。核心在于平衡用户体验与盈利需求,同时通过持续优化与创新技术提升竞争力,开发者需关注行业动态,灵活调整策略,才能在激烈的市场中脱颖而出。

扫描二维码推送至手机访问。

版权声明:本文由码界编程网发布,如需转载请注明出处。

本文链接:http://b2b.dropc.cn/xxfs/8854.html

分享给朋友:

“捕鱼游戏源码,全新捕鱼游戏源码揭秘” 的相关文章

innerhtml和outerhtml的区别,深入解析,innerHTML与outerHTML的区别

innerhtml和outerhtml的区别,深入解析,innerHTML与outerHTML的区别

InnerHTML和OuterHTML是HTML DOM中用于获取和设置元素内容的属性,innerHTML获取或设置元素内部的HTML内容,包括元素内的文本和子元素,但不包括元素本身,设置一个div的innerHTML为"Hello",它会将div的内部内容替换为Hello,而OuterHTML获取...

mysql创建数据库和表,MySQL快速创建数据库与表教程

mysql创建数据库和表,MySQL快速创建数据库与表教程

MySQL创建数据库和表的基本步骤如下:使用CREATE DATABASE语句创建一个新的数据库,指定数据库名称,选择该数据库,使用CREATE TABLE语句创建一个新表,指定表名和列定义,每个表由列组成,每列有数据类型和可选的属性,如主键、自增等。,``sql,CREATE DATABASE m...

enumerate函数,深入解析Python中的enumerate函数

enumerate函数,深入解析Python中的enumerate函数

enumerate函数是Python内置的一个函数,用于将可迭代对象(如列表、元组、字符串等)转换成索引值和元素值组成的枚举对象,通过enumerate,可以在遍历可迭代对象时同时获取到元素的索引和值,使得处理元素的同时知道它们的位置,提高代码的可读性和便捷性,使用方法简单,只需在可迭代对象后面添加...

html登录按钮,HTML实现动态登录按钮设计教程

html登录按钮,HTML实现动态登录按钮设计教程

HTML登录按钮是指使用HTML代码创建的用于用户登录操作的按钮,它通常包含一个图标或文本“登录”,并嵌入在网页的登录表单中,该按钮通过JavaScript与后端服务器交互,实现用户输入的用户名和密码的验证,在样式上,登录按钮可以通过CSS进行美化,以符合网站的整体设计风格。HTML登录按钮:设计与...

设计一个数据库系统,构建高效数据库系统架构

设计一个数据库系统,构建高效数据库系统架构

设计一个数据库系统需要明确系统目标、数据需求、功能需求以及性能要求,进行需求分析,确定数据模型和系统架构,选择合适的数据库管理系统(DBMS),如MySQL、Oracle或MongoDB,根据数据类型和查询需求,设计数据库表结构,确保数据完整性和一致性,编写SQL语句进行数据操作,包括创建、查询、更...

log公式一览表,数学常用对数公式速查表

log公式一览表,数学常用对数公式速查表

提供了一份log公式一览表,涵盖了对数函数的基本公式、换底公式、对数性质、对数与指数函数的关系等,摘要如下:该一览表详细列出了对数函数及其相关公式的应用,包括对数的基本运算规则、换底公式的应用以及与指数函数的结合,旨在帮助学习者快速查阅和掌握对数运算的相关知识。用户提问:我最近在学习对数函数,想了解...